Hope someone can help with this

if i type the name of my site with a www. prefix it is truncated to the site name without the www - i think its been redirected

I presume that google sees the two versions as seperate so therfore i have to concentrate my seo on the non www version

Or am i been thick

    If you type in the www and it bounces you to the "non" www, then yes, it's being redirected.

    That's a good thing though as long as it's done correctly.

    Google sees www and non-www as two different entries and since in this case they have the same content on them, will penalize you a little bit for that.

    It does NOT make a huge difference in my experience, but best to set it up when you start and focus your attention on one or the other... just don't backlink with www in the url.

    Your server is doing that, yout control panel may offer the option to:
    force www
    remove www
    leave www as is

    Also can be hand coded in? .htttaccess

    I've herd elsewhere that you should maintain a consistent form.
